Bank of New York Mellon Corp decreased its holdings in shares of UBS Group AG (NYSE:UBS – Free Report) by 3.6% during the 1st quarter, according to the company in its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The institutional investor owned 6,502,710 shares of the bank’s stock after selling 246,082 shares during the period. Bank of New York Mellon Corp’s holdings in UBS Group were worth $254,061,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

UBS Group Trading Down 1.5%
Shares of UBS opened at $52.72 on Friday. The stock has a market capitalization of $164.70 billion, a P/E ratio of 18.90, a PEG ratio of 0.83 and a beta of 1.19. UBS Group AG has a twelve month low of $35.94 and a twelve month high of $55.15. The company has a quick ratio of 1.19, a current ratio of 0.85 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 1.23. The firm has a fifty day simple moving average of $49.06 and a two-hundred day simple moving average of $45.01.
UBS Group (NYSE:UBS – Get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ings data on Wednesday, April 29th. The bank reported $0.94 EPS for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$0.85 by $0.09. UBS Group had a net margin of 12.66% and a return on equity of 10.05%. The firm had revenue of $13.64 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$13.16 billion. On average, research analysts anticipate that UBS Group AG will post 3.51 EPS for the current year.
UBS Group Profile
UBS Group AG is a Swiss multinational financial services firm that provides a broad range of banking and capital markets services to private, institutional and corporate clients. Headquartered in Zurich, UBS operates as a universal bank with a primary focus on wealth management, asset management, investment banking and retail and commercial banking in Switzerland. The firm serves high-net-worth and ultra-high-net-worth individuals, pension funds, corporations and institutional investors through a global network of offices.
Key business activities include global wealth management—offering financial planning, investment advisory, discretionary portfolio management and custody services—alongside asset management products for institutional and retail investors.
